    Of course those folks will not attack us directly, but they can use their military forces to create choke points, implement national strategy, and deny our access to critical areas. Also, they can make life miserable for our allies and we would be powerless to assist. As Clausewitz states, "War is merely the continuation of policy by other means." Before it gets to that level however, military forces, just by being, can enforce national policy goals. Do you really think that the Iranians and North Koreans would have remained relatively "good" all these years without the threat of the U.S. military intervening? That China would not have already retaken Taiwan and established a hegemony in the western Pacific? Last time we had a relatively weak military force, we ended up in WW II. Deterrence of the bad guys is a good thing. And sometimes the only way to achieve that is having a military that scares, or at least worries, them.

    Quote Originally Posted by saltydawg View Post
    The countries that developed flat screen tv's put more R&D money into developing commercial products and not into military or space areas.

    Of course a lot of those countries did not put a lot of R&D money in defense because they allowed the U.S. to protect them. Had they carried their fair share of the burden, the flat screens might not be so flat today.... :icon_wink:


    S. Korea, Japan, Taiwan, and even a fair amount of the Euro's, while funding some of their defense, have basically stood behind the U.S. military for protection for decades. Had they not had the American shield and were forced to fund their total defense needs on their own, I suspect things would look different a little different now.

    But I wonder if they are going to continue to replace the current Nimitz class carriers with the Ford class. So far, the Enterprise* (2013), Nimitz (2018), and Eisenhower (2021) are scheduled to be replaced by the Ford (half-way) and Kennedy (maybe 1/5) that are already under construction and CVN-80 (hasn't been started), but theoretically they could be cancelled since the government has no qualms in pulling the plug after already spending millions on something.


    *The Enterprise isn't a Nimitz class carrier.
